Hidden Costs in Travel and How Booking Websites Charge You More

A recent market analysis by Ryanair has revealed that some online travel agencies (OTAs), including eDreams, Vola, and Booking.com, apply significant markups on airline services. These platforms have been found to charge up to 220% more for seat reservations, luggage fees, and even standard airfares compared to direct airline prices. For example, Vola listed a reserved seat for €15.99, whereas the same seat was available on Ryanair’s website for just €5.00. Similarly, eDreams priced a 10kg checked bag at €32.29, more than double Ryanair's €14.29. These discrepancies raise concerns about the transparency of pricing structures within third-party booking platforms.

Data from the March 2025 survey also highlights that Booking.com inflates prices on other airlines. A seat on an easyJet flight, which costs £7.49 when booked directly through the airline, was being offered for £10.46 via Booking.com, reflecting a 40% increase. Airfares also saw unjustified markups, with a flight listed at £98.53 instead of the airline’s direct price of £84.99. These findings suggest that travelers using OTAs may unknowingly pay significantly more for identical services, reinforcing the importance of verifying costs before completing bookings.

This means a financial strain, especially for people who are cash strapped. The extra cost of basic services like seat selections and baggage fees can add up, so your trips can get out of hand much faster. Instead of benefiting from perceived convenience, many travelers find themselves paying inflated prices for services that could be booked directly at a lower cost. In addition to the non-existent breakdown of prices on OTA websites, this does not help consumers make an informed buying choice.

To avoid unnecessary expenses, travelers are encouraged to cross-check prices between OTAs and airline websites before finalizing purchases. Booking directly with airlines remains the most transparent and cost-effective approach, ensuring access to genuine rates and airline promotions. Additionally, utilizing flight comparison tools that include direct airline pricing can help travelers identify discrepancies. Consumer awareness and careful research remain key to minimizing unexpected charges and optimizing travel budgets.

The increasing proof of over-the-top OTA markups indicates that there should be stricter consumer protections in travel. Pricing transparency is key to avoiding the manipulation that can cause a loss of trust for travelers. Until regulatory changes are made, individuals need to stay on guard for booking flights along associated services. By prioritizing direct purchases and staying informed, travelers can safeguard their budgets and ensure fair pricing in an increasingly complex booking landscape.
